Sedum laxum
Sedum laxum
Stonecrop
Blue-green evergreen rosettes of 3/4" spatulate leaves are topped with light yellow flowers in late summer. An excellent NW native plant for the rockery, it should be planted more often! (Perennial,Groundcover)
